2014-01-15 2 views

답변

1

당신이 경우에 backrec 또는 None에서 해결책을 반환 할 단 하나 개의 솔루션을 필요로하는 경우 대신 당신은 단지에 저장할 수있는 모든 솔루션을 필요로하는 경우 솔루션을

if solution(x): 
    return x 
else: 
    res = backrec(x[:]) 
    if res: 
     return res 

을 찾을 수없이 당신은 루프를 종료 그 (것)들을 인쇄하기 대신 목록. 마지막에 목록이 비어 있으면 솔루션이 없음을 알 수 있습니다.

관련 문제